New Primary Care Centre in Lytham now open

June 3, 2009 12:30 pm

After serveral years working directly for Fylde Primary Care Trust (PCT) later North Lancs PCT. brp architects were novated after national competition to deliver the scheme to developers Primary Asset Ltd.

The project became operational on 1st June 2009 after its official opening by Lord Shuttleworth on 21st May.

This multi user facility comprising; two GP surgeries, pharmacy, healthy eating cafe and extensive PCT services including diagnostics, minor ops. Community Team and Health Port.

The contemporary design complements the immediate context and makes references to the history of the locality particularly the former Victorian Hospital through the use of traditional materials and colour palette assembled in a contemporary manner along with reclaimed artefacts from the original hospital.

The cruciform plan form provides compact accommodation over three floors for a total area of 4,500sq.m. The building is constructed using a full steel frame focussed around a triple heighcentral atrium bringing light and natural ventilation to the heart of the deep plan space.
